- Spicer Life non-greaseable universal joint with snap rings
- Inside and Outside Snap Ring Style (1330 OSR / S44 ISR)
- 1330/S44 Series
- Bearing Cap Diameter (OSR): 1.062 inches / Bearing Cap Diameter (ISR): 1.125 inches
- Bearing Cap to Bearing Cap (OSR): 3.625 inches / Length Between Snap Rings (ISR): 2.556 inches
- Spicer genuine OE replacement
- Inside and outside snap rings
- Outside to outside dimension: 3.625 inch; outside bearing cup dimension: 1.062 inch
- Inside to inside dimension: 2.556 inch; inside bearing cup dimension: 1.125 inch

This Ujoint Fits 2002 GMC sierra ext cab 1500 with 4×4 for aluminum rear drive shafts. It is a strong ujoint since it’s a non greasble. For position at rear diff, Driveshaft side is 1.062 with bronze clips and rear diff pinion is 1.125 with inside snap rings. Dana Spicer driveline parts are the best but this product sucks with plastic cap seals, broke the plastic seal on install with ujoint press and impact drill on low, do it with a ratchet and be very careful! I had other ujoint cap seals luckily that fit the cap! So I just switched it out to a rubber one instead of plastic, I also Used spicer 5-1330x for the Slip yoke side to T-case, size 1.062 all 4 caps that ujoint is much better built because it has rubber seals for caps and install went well! Unfortunately there is 2 different ujoints for these aluminum rear drive shafts so your kinda forced to get this one for the rear if you want spicer!
